Experimental Research of Round Bloom Continuous Casting Process

Abstract:In order to improve the quality of round blooms, based on technical parameters of round bloom continuous caster at Ma’anshan Iron and Steel Co., Ltd.,Gleeble2000 was used to study the mechanical properties of CL60 round bloom under high temperature.A secondary cooling model was built by theoretical analysis and experimental study,the effect of MEMS parameters on bloom quality was analyzed. The results show that the plasticity of CL60 steel is good enough in the range of 9001200 ℃, the secondary cooling model is able to control the bloom quality, the usage of MEMS can increase the ratio of equiaxed crystal zone, lower segregation and porosity, improve the distribution of inclusions.
